导航
当前位置:首页 >> 阿里云 >>

阿里云服务器上搭建、配置和管理MySQL数据库

2025-07-16 来源 :一万网络 围观 :1244次

阿里云服务器MySQL数据库:搭建、配置与管理

在现代信息化时代,企业对数据存储和管理的需求日益增长。作为全球领先的云计算服务提供商,阿里云提供了强大的MySQL数据库解决方案。本文将深入探讨如何在阿里云服务器上高效地搭建、配置以及管理MySQL数据库。

一、准备工作

在开始搭建之前,需要确保已具备必要的硬件资源和软件环境。首先,选择适合业务需求的阿里云服务器实例类型,例如计算优化型C系列或内存优化型R系列,以满足高并发访问和大规模数据处理的需求。其次,安装操作系统并完成基本的安全配置,包括更新系统补丁、关闭不必要的服务端口以及设置防火墙规则。

二、MySQL数据库的部署

部署MySQL数据库的过程可以分为以下几个步骤:

  • 下载最新稳定版本的MySQL安装包,并将其上传至阿里云服务器。
  • 解压安装包后运行安装脚本,按照提示完成数据库引擎的初始化工作。
  • 配置my.cnf文件,调整参数如innodb_buffer_pool_size、max_connections等,以优化性能表现。
  • 创建管理员账户并授予相应的权限,同时禁用默认用户以增强安全性。

三、数据库的日常维护

为了保证MySQL数据库长期稳定运行,必须定期执行以下维护任务:

  • 监控数据库状态,及时发现并解决潜在问题,例如通过慢查询日志定位执行效率低下的SQL语句。
  • 备份重要数据,推荐采用增量备份策略以减少存储开销,同时制定详细的恢复计划以防意外丢失。
  • 升级数据库版本至最新稳定版,以便利用新特性提升功能体验并修复已知漏洞。

四、高级配置技巧

除了基础操作外,还有一些高级技巧可以帮助进一步提升MySQL数据库的表现:

  • 启用二进制日志功能,便于实现主从复制架构,从而提高系统的可用性和容灾能力。
  • 合理规划表结构设计,避免冗余字段导致的数据膨胀现象,同时遵循第三范式原则减少数据冗余。
  • 利用分区表技术将大表划分为多个子表,不仅能够改善查询速度,还能简化管理流程。

五、故障排查与应急响应

尽管采取了诸多预防措施,但仍然无法完全杜绝故障的发生。当遇到诸如死锁、连接超时等问题时,应迅速采取行动:

  • 检查错误日志文件,确认问题根源所在,必要时联系技术支持寻求帮助。
  • 重启相关服务或重启整个数据库实例,但需谨慎操作以免造成额外损失。
  • 启动备用服务器接管业务流量,确保核心业务不受影响。

总之,在阿里云平台上管理和维护MySQL数据库是一项复杂且重要的任务。只有掌握了扎实的技术功底,并结合实际应用场景灵活运用各种工具与方法,才能真正发挥出这一强大平台的价值。

相关文章
  • 阿里云服务器配置及价格表

    阿里云服务器产品与服务价格配置详解阿里云作为国内领先的云计算服务提供商,其服务器产品线丰富多样,旨在满足不同行业和企业的需求。本篇文章将详细介绍阿里云服务器的价...

    2026-04-21 10:32:48
  • 阿里云服务器配置好后如何修改

    阿里云服务器部署完成后修改配置指南在完成阿里云服务器的初始部署后,用户可能需要根据实际需求对系统配置进行调整。无论是优化性能还是增强安全性,了解如何高效地修改服...

    2026-04-21 10:32:48
  • 阿里云服务器配置参考

    阿里云服务器配置选型指南云计算技术的迅猛发展为企业提供了高效便捷的IT资源获取方式。作为国内领先的云服务提供商阿里云推出了多种类型的服务器实例以满足不同业务场景...

    2026-04-21 10:32:48
  • 阿里云服务器配置如何挑选

    如何科学选择阿里云服务器实例规格在云计算时代,选择适合的服务器实例规格是确保业务高效运行和成本优化的关键步骤。阿里云作为全球领先的云服务提供商,提供了种类繁多的...

    2026-04-21 10:32:48
  • 阿里云服务器配置如何查看

    如何查看阿里云服务器的配置了解阿里云服务器的配置是确保系统运行高效的基础。无论是初次部署还是进行日常维护,掌握查看配置的方法都至关重要。以下是几种常见的查看方式...

    2026-04-21 10:32:47